The real winner on Friday might be Mother Nature. The forecast calls for more rain that could wreak havoc with the WPIAL baseball and softball schedule.

However, if the forecast is off and games can be played, there are three matchups in Section 4-5A softball that will help determine the section leaders heading into the weekend.

Part of the reason every section game plays a role in the leaderboard is because only one game separates all six teams in the section.

Bethel Park is 2-1 in the section and Upper St. Clair is 1-2. The other four teams, Trinity, Connellsville, Peters Township and Thomas Jefferson, are all 1-1.

On Friday, Bethel Park hosts Connellsville, Trinity visits Thomas Jefferson, and Peters Township welcomes Upper St. Clair.

Section 1 showdowns

First place is up for grabs in Section 1 in a two different softball classifications Friday.

In Section 1-2A, Riverside (2-1) visits Neshannock (3-0). Both teams are 2-0 and tied for first in the section.

In Section 1-A, South Side (3-2) is home to two-time defending champion Union (4-0). The Scotties are 3-0 in the section while the Rams are a half-game back at 2-0.
